ALBANY – Mary Jane (Adamson) Zehner, age 98, Albany, died Saturday evening at Community Hospital, Anderson, following an extended illness.  Born in Kentucky on July 10, 1919, she lived most of her life near Albany.  She was married to William H. Zehner for several years before his death and was a homemaker.

Survivors include two daughters: Myrna Huffman (husband: Jim), Albany, and Jo Ann Ashcraft (husband: Jim), Pendleton; three grandchildren: Ericka Alley (husband: Mike), Kent Ashcraft, and Mary Ann Ashcraft; three great-grandchildren: Jacob Alley, Logan Alley (wife: Michelle), and Cy Alley; also, two great-great grandchildren: Wyatt Alley and Scarlett Alley.

She is preceded in death by her husband, parents, a brother, and two sisters.

Services will be 1 p.m. Friday, September 8, 2017 at Meacham Funeral Service with burial following at Black Cemetery.

Visiting hours will be held on Friday from 12 until 1p.m. at the funeral home.
